There exist no pre-compiled LMS package for OpenWrt. I could go down the path of trying to make it work (following instructions for making LMS work on Linux), but I fear the Perl-based thingy would be too hungry for resources to work properly on the router. Also, I don't need all the frills and thrills of LMS, as written in the first post.
What I am really after is a minimal server that mimics MySB.com and gives me the list of settings, presets, alarms and nothing else.
